+# Blitz Documentation
+
+This directory contains the documentation for Blitz, which is automatically built and deployed to GitHub Pages.
+
+## Local Development
+
+To preview the documentation locally using Jekyll:
+
+```bash
+cd docs
+bundle install
+bundle exec jekyll serve
+```
+
+Then open [http://localhost:4000](http://localhost:4000) in your browser.
+
+## GitHub Pages Setup
+
+The documentation is automatically deployed to GitHub Pages via the `.github/workflows/pages.yml` workflow.
+
+To enable GitHub Pages:
+
+1. Go to your repository settings on GitHub
+2. Navigate to "Pages" in the left sidebar
+3. Under "Source", select "GitHub Actions"
+4. The site will be automatically built and deployed when changes are pushed to the `main` branch
+
+The production site will be available at: `https://observiq.github.io/blitz/`
+
+## Testing on Branches
+
+You can test documentation changes on branches before merging to `main`:
+
+### Pull Request Previews
+
+When you open a pull request that modifies documentation files:
+- The workflow automatically builds and deploys a preview
+- A preview URL will be posted as a comment on the PR
+- The preview is available for review before merging
+
+### Branch Testing
+
+When you push changes to any branch (not just `main`):
+- The workflow builds the site
+- For non-main branches, it deploys to a preview environment
+- You can view the preview URL in the workflow run summary
+
+This allows you to:
+- Test documentation changes in isolation
+- Share preview links with reviewers
+- Verify links and formatting before merging

+# Blitz
+
+A load generation tool for Bindplane managed collectors.

+## Components
+
+Blitz consists of generators that create log data and outputs that send data to destinations.
+
+### Generators
+
+- **[nop](generator/nop.md)** - No operation generator for testing infrastructure without generating data
+- **[json](generator/json.md)** - Generates structured JSON logs
+- **[winevt](generator/winevt.md)** - Generates Windows Event logs in unparsed XML format
+- **[palo-alto](generator/palo-alto.md)** - Generates realistic Palo Alto firewall syslog entries
+- **[apache-common](generator/apache-common.md)** - Generates Apache Common Log Format (CLF) entries
+- **[apache-combined](generator/apache-combined.md)** - Generates Apache Combined Log Format entries with referer and user-agent
+- **[apache-error](generator/apache-error.md)** - Generates Apache Error Log Format entries for server diagnostics
+- **[nginx](generator/nginx.md)** - Generates NGINX Combined Log Format entries matching NGINX's default log format
+- **[postgres](generator/postgres.md)** - Generates PostgreSQL log format entries including query logs, connections, and database events
+
+### Outputs
+
+- **[nop](output/nop.md)** - No operation output for testing infrastructure without sending data
+- **[stdout](output/stdout.md)** - Writes logs to standard output for debugging and testing
+- **[tcp](output/tcp.md)** - Sends logs over TCP connections with optional TLS encryption
+- **[udp](output/udp.md)** - Sends logs over UDP connections
+- **[syslog](output/syslog.md)** - Formats and sends logs via syslog (RFC 3164 or 5424) over UDP or TCP
+- **[otlp-grpc](output/otlp-grpc.md)** - Sends logs via OpenTelemetry Protocol (OTLP) over gRPC
+- **[file](output/file.md)** - Writes logs to files with automatic rotation and compression

+## Installation
+
+Blitz supports the following platforms:
+- **Operating Systems**: Linux, macOS (Darwin), Windows, FreeBSD
+- **CPU Architectures**: amd64 (x86_64), arm64
+
+If your platform is not listed above, please [open an issue](https://github.com/observiq/blitz/issues)
+and we'll do our best to add support for it.
+
+### CLI
+
+Download the binary for your platform from the [latest release](https://github.com/observiq/blitz/releases/latest):
+
+Extract the archive and run the binary directly in a terminal:
+
+```bash
+tar -xzf blitz_*_linux_amd64.tar.gz
+```
+
+Run with default NOP configuration:
+
+```bash
+./blitz
+```
+
+Run with JSON generator and TCP output:
+
+```bash
+./blitz \
+ --generator-type json \
+ --generator-json-workers 2 \
+ --generator-json-rate 500ms \
+ --output-type tcp \
+ --output-tcp-host logs.example.com \
+ --output-tcp-port 9090 \
+ --output-tcp-workers 3 \
+ --logging-level info
+```
+
+### Linux Systemd Service
+
+Download the appropriate package for your Linux distribution from the [latest release](https://github.com/observiq/blitz/releases/latest):
+
+- **Debian/Ubuntu**: `blitz_amd64.deb` or `blitz_arm64.deb`
+- **Red Hat/CentOS/Fedora**: `blitz_amd64.rpm` or `blitz_arm64.rpm`
+
+Install the package with your package manager:
+
+**Debian**
+
+```bash
+sudo apt-get install -f ./blitz_amd64.deb
+```
+
+**RHEL**
+
+```bash
+sudo dnf install ./blitz_amd64.rpm
+```
+
+Edit the configuration file:
+
+```bash
+sudo vi /etc/blitz/config.yaml
+```
+
+Example minimal configuration for JSON generator and TCP output:
+
+```yaml
+generator:
+ type: json
+ json:
+ workers: 2
+ rate: 500ms
+output:
+ type: tcp
+ tcp:
+ host: logs.example.com
+ port: 9090
+ workers: 3
+logging:
+ level: info
+```
+
+Enable and start the service
+
+```bash
+sudo systemctl enable blitz
+sudo systemctl start blitz
+sudo systemctl status blitz
+```
+
+View service logs:
+
+```bash
+sudo journalctl -u blitz -f
+```
+
+### Container
+
+Pull the Docker image from GitHub Container Registry and run it with environment variables for configuration:
+
+Run with default NOP configuration:
+
+```bash
+docker run --rm ghcr.io/observiq/blitz:latest
+```
+
+Run with JSON generator and TCP output:
+
+```bash
+docker run --rm \
+ -e BINDPLANE_GENERATOR_TYPE=json \
+ -e BINDPLANE_GENERATOR_JSON_WORKERS=2 \
+ -e BINDPLANE_GENERATOR_JSON_RATE=500ms \
+ -e BINDPLANE_OUTPUT_TYPE=tcp \
+ -e BINDPLANE_OUTPUT_TCP_HOST=logs.example.com \
+ -e BINDPLANE_OUTPUT_TCP_PORT=9090 \
+ -e BINDPLANE_OUTPUT_TCP_WORKERS=3 \
+ -e BINDPLANE_LOGGING_LEVEL=info \
+ ghcr.io/observiq/blitz:latest
+```
+
+For detailed configuration options, see the [Configuration Guide](configuration.md).
